IRC Building Code Compliance
Ensures maximum 7-3/4" unit rise and minimum 10" run with consistent tread heights throughout.
Blondel Comfort Formula
2 ร Rise + Run = 24 to 25 inches: the ergonomic human cadence standard for zero-trip climbing.
Stringer Cut Dimensions
Accounting for finish tread thickness when dropping the bottom stringer notch.
